Output d2fc23fceb44573852212a2dff7e0465da68362ce67dcbb17186a0fe6bd0d945:2

value
1015692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ade132ff8f5bba1f04850f649c1f02650fe3950e OP_EQUAL
address
3HYQbr28i4aCP3JcxnT7Ld1qbr2aHsnYhT
transaction
d2fc23fceb44573852212a2dff7e0465da68362ce67dcbb17186a0fe6bd0d945
spent
true